COMMUNITY NEWS
- ➤ The former Vigo County Jail in Indiana is set to be demolished in October, with plans for the Terre Haute Police Department to use it for explosive and other training types beforehand, and the site to ultimately become a green space. WTHI-TV
- ➤ In Terre Haute, a new plaza called Purple Eagle Plaza was unveiled as a tribute to the former Garfield High School, featuring a sculpture by Bill Wolfe and bricks named after ex-students. WTHI-TV
ECONOMY NEWS
- ➤ Terre Haute experiences a 18% rise in tourism, driven by events and new attractions like the Larry Bird Museum, enhancing local economic and community development. WTHI-TV
EDUCATION NEWS
- ➤ Indiana State University students aid in solving crimes by processing digital forensic evidence for the High Tech Crime Unit, contributing to local law enforcement efforts including a notable murder case conviction. Tribune-Star
GOVERNMENT NEWS
- ➤ The Indiana Black Legislative Caucus is set to host a town hall in Terre Haute to discuss community and state issues directly with constituents. WTWO
- ➤ Vigo County Council reviewed diverse funding appeals, including jail commissary expenditure by the sheriff, land appraisals, a vehicle for juvenile transportation, bump in base pay for Parks and Recreation, levee elevation for flood prevention, and courthouse security enhancements, with decisions pending for the next meeting. Tribune-Star
HEALTH NEWS
- ➤ A court ruled Indiana must ensure two families receive in-home skilled nursing for their medically fragile children as they transition to Structured Family Caregiving, addressing gaps in Medicaid services. Tribune-Star
